SMCC (9-1) is coming off of a 62-8 week one playoff win over Grass Lake. Clinton (10-0) defeated Manchester for the 2nd time this season in the first week of the playoffs 42-6. These teams have met five times over the years with SMCC having won all five games.
SMCC got to business early last week by scoring 8 TD’s in the first quarter and a half against Grass Lake. The Falcons are led by senior QB Bryce Windham. SMCC faces a bruising running game from any of a number of backs led by Justin Carrabino, John Lako and Mitchell Lamour.
The Falcon defense is fast and disciplined while giving up less than 7 ppg. Justin LaPlante, Troy Hilkens, Darius Marks and Travis Vuich lead the defense which will be challenged by the speed of Clinton.
Clinton made it to the state title game last season and boast a powerful offense that is averaging nearly 50 ppg. The Redskins have two 1,000 yard rushers in senior Collin Poore and junior Matt Sexton. Senior QB Ryan Karapas has thrown 8 TD’s in only 49 pass attempts this season.
The defense is led by a host of juniors. Speedy LB Noah Poore and DE Ken DeShano along with DT David Chantelois and LB Blake Rogers are part of a defensive unit that gives up just under 12 ppg. Perhaps the best defensive player for the Redskins is senior MLB Seth Sylvester.
This is a game that is worthy of a state semifinal match up as opposed to a district final. Clinton’s offense and SMCC’s defense will be fun to watch as they try to force their wills on one another. The problem for Clinton is they have to stop a Falcon offense who runs on everyone they meet including playoff qualifiers Lansing Catholic, New Boston Huron, Riverview and Grosse Ile. Prediction: SMCC 30 Clinton 21
